The Advanced Certificate in Drug Repositioning for Enhanced Innovation is a comprehensive course designed to meet the growing industry demand for professionals with expertise in drug repositioning. This certificate program emphasizes the importance of repurposing existing drugs for new therapeutic indications, thereby reducing costs, shortening development timelines, and minimizing risks associated with de novo drug discovery.
